Transaction d7c5cae2614f7b59465756f55970d19990b61813e5bcca2e589e71016b60ebfa

2 Input
2 Outputs
  • d7c5cae2614f7b59465756f55970d19990b61813e5bcca2e589e71016b60ebfa:0
  • value  3805929
    address  15XLrNBC2YRkpxbpru25dBUXe8JpymY9g4
  • d7c5cae2614f7b59465756f55970d19990b61813e5bcca2e589e71016b60ebfa:1
  • value  25000000
    address  1PvhSboMcskAp3d4aDgKFYn8aNPcu3wieA